There are numerous forms of insurance accessible, each designed to meet varied requirements and situations. The most common forms include liability insurance, collision insurance, and comprehensive insurance. Liability insurance covers for damages or harm you cause to other people in an accident, while collision insurance helps cover for fixes to your own vehicle after an accident, regardless of who is at fault. Comprehensive coverage safeguards against non-collision incidents, such as stealing, damage, or disasters.Another significant type of automobile coverage is personal injury protection and medical expense coverage. This type of coverage covers for medical expenses for you and your passengers after an accident, regardless of fault. PIP can also cover lost wages and other related costs, making it a essential option for those worried about health costs following an incident. Some jurisdictions require PIP coverage, while others offer it as an optional add-on.Finally, uninsured or lacking sufficient motorist insurance protects you in cases where the responsible driver does not have coverage or does not possess adequate coverage to pay for the damages. This type of automobile coverage is crucial, as it guarantees that you are not left bearing the costs for repairs and medical costs due to someone else's negligence. One of the primary factors is the kind of car you drive. Cars that are more expensive to fix or substitute will typically lead to increased insurance costs. Additionally, cars with a greater probability of theft or those that lack safety features can result in higher premiums. Insurance providers typically evaluate the danger associated with various makes and this can directly influence how many you pay.Your operating record also plays a crucial part in determining insurance fees. Motorists with clean histories, free of accidents and traffic violations, are often offered with reduced premiums. Conversely, a history of accidents or violations can indicate to insurers that you are a higher risk, leading in increased rates. Frequent reviewing your operating habits and aiming for cautious driving can assist keep your premiums in control.Another significant factor is your area. The area where you live can affect your premium due to different threats. Urban settings tend to have higher rates of collisions and theft compared to countryside areas, which can result to increased premiums for drivers in urban areas.
